We did enjoy the experience when we went, and I learned that people take their own gingerbread house decorations to use in addition to the ones provided by the Jazz Kitchen. Also, be prepared to carry your house back to the car so you may want to take something to carry it in instead of just the plate used when building it.
 
We had a blast doing this. We had heard that it's smart to bring your own decorations to supplement what they give you so we stopped at Target and bought a bunch. It did not help the creations my sister and I managed to assemble but then neither did the martinis we had during the process 🤣. Definitely bring something to take it home in if you plan to keep it.
